La programación es una tarea compleja que requiere de una gran atención al detalle y de una alta capacidad de concentración. Uno de los errores más comunes que se cometen en la programación son los errores de sintaxis. Estos errores ocurren cuando se escribe un código que no sigue las reglas sintácticas del lenguaje de programación utilizado.
En Python, un error de sintaxis ocurre cuando se escribe un código que no sigue las reglas sintácticas del lenguaje. Por ejemplo, si se escribe una línea de código sin colocar los paréntesis de cierre, el programa arrojará un error de sintaxis. Los errores de sintaxis en Python son fáciles de identificar, ya que el programa mostrará un mensaje de error en la consola indicando la línea de código donde se encuentra el error.
A diferencia de los errores de sintaxis, los errores de semántica ocurren cuando el código está bien escrito, pero no hace lo que se espera que haga. Por ejemplo, si se escribe un código que suma dos números pero se utiliza el operador de resta, el programa arrojará un resultado incorrecto. Los errores de semántica son más difíciles de identificar y solucionar que los errores de sintaxis, ya que no siempre hay un mensaje de error que los indique.
Además de los errores de sintaxis y semántica, existen otros errores que se cometen en la programación, como los errores de lógica y los errores de tiempo de ejecución. Los errores de lógica ocurren cuando el programador no ha pensado en todas las posibles situaciones que pueden ocurrir en el programa, mientras que los errores de tiempo de ejecución ocurren cuando ocurre un problema durante la ejecución del programa, como una división por cero.
Para solucionar estos errores, es importante realizar pruebas exhaustivas del programa antes de su lanzamiento y utilizar herramientas de depuración para identificar los errores que puedan surgir durante la ejecución del programa.
Para solucionar errores en Java, se recomienda utilizar herramientas de depuración como Eclipse o NetBeans, que permiten identificar los errores y proporcionar sugerencias para solucionarlos. También es importante revisar el código cuidadosamente y realizar pruebas exhaustivas del programa antes de su lanzamiento.
Para corregir un error en Visual Basic, se recomienda utilizar el depurador integrado en el IDE de Visual Basic. El depurador permite identificar los errores y proporcionar sugerencias para solucionarlos. Además, es importante revisar el código cuidadosamente y realizar pruebas exhaustivas del programa antes de su lanzamiento.
Si te sale un error de Python en QGIS, lo primero que debes hacer es leer cuidadosamente el mensaje de error para entender cuál es el problema. Luego, puedes buscar información en línea para tratar de solucionar el error o pedir ayuda en foros o comunidades de programación. También es importante verificar que estás utilizando la versión correcta de Python y que tienes todas las librerías necesarias instaladas. Si todo lo demás falla, puedes considerar contactar al soporte técnico de QGIS para obtener ayuda adicional.
En Python, se pueden declarar atributos en una clase utilizando el método especial «init» (__init__) que se llama cuando se crea una nueva instancia de la clase. En el método init, se pueden definir los atributos de la instancia utilizando la sintaxis «self.nombre_atributo = valor». Por ejemplo:
«`
class Persona:
def __init__(self, nombre, edad):
self.nombre = nombre
self.edad = edad
persona1 = Persona(«Juan», 30)
print(persona1.nombre) # Salida: Juan
print(persona1.edad) # Salida: 30
«`
En este ejemplo, la clase Persona tiene dos atributos: nombre y edad. Estos atributos se definen en el método init utilizando la sintaxis «self.nombre_atributo = valor». Luego se crea una nueva instancia de la clase Persona y se asignan valores a los atributos. Finalmente, se imprimen los valores de los atributos utilizando la sintaxis «instancia.nombre_atributo».
La semántica en programación se refiere al significado de las instrucciones escritas en un lenguaje de programación. Es decir, cómo se interpretan y ejecutan las instrucciones para lograr un resultado específico.
Un ejemplo de semántica en programación es el uso de variables y su asignación de valores. Si se asigna un valor incorrecto a una variable, la semántica de la instrucción se verá afectada y el resultado esperado no se logrará. Otro ejemplo es el uso de operadores lógicos y aritméticos, donde un uso incorrecto puede afectar la semántica de la instrucción y generar un resultado no deseado.